madrina

godmother

noun mah-DREE-nah Rare

Also means

sponsor

Usage Note

Madrina is the feminine counterpart of padrino (godfather). Beyond the religious role at baptism, it is also used for a person who officially sponsors or inaugurates something, such as a ship (la madrina della nave) or an event. The plural is madrine.

Examples

"La madrina ha tenuto il bambino durante il battesimo."

Natural Translation

The godmother held the child during the baptism.
